Weatherly International PLC26 June 2007 Weatherly International plc (the 'Company') Appointment of Director Weatherly International plc (WTI), the integrated mining group with mining andsmelting operations in Namibia, is pleased to announce the appointment of PaulCraven as Chief Financial Officer and executive director, effective immediately. Mr Craven has a wealth of experience in managing and developing large projectsin the mining, renewable and power industries around the world. Prior to joiningWeatherly, he has held a number of senior positions with National Power, Innogyand ReEnergy Group. Commenting on the announcement, Rod Webster, CEO, said: "I am delighted towelcome Paul to the Board of Weatherly. This appointment further strengthens themanagement team and I believe Paul will make a significant contribution inbuilding Weatherly into a major southern African base metals producer." For further information contact: John Norris, Weatherly International plc: +44 (0) 20 7917 2989 +44 (0) 7929 778 251Stephen Pickup, Libertas Capital: +44 (0) 20 7569 9650 Allan Piper, First City Financial Public Relations: +44 (0) 20 7242 2666 Background details follow: Weatherly International plc arrived on AIM at 3p per in June 2005. Following theacquisition of 97% of Namibia's Ongopolo Mining & processing Ltd in October 2006,it is now positioned as a fully integrated mining group owning mining exploration and production assets and one of only four copper smelters in Southern Africa. The company is currently producing copper from mines in the Tsumeb area ofNorthern Namibia and at Otjihase and Matchless around the Namibian capital,Windhoek. Weatherly is also continuing work at its Kombat West mine, where it isdewatering underground workings. The smelter at Tsumeb in Northern Namibia, owned by Weatherly's subsidiaryNamibian Custom Smelters, is processing material from Weatherly's own mines withadditional throughput from tolling agreements and third party sales. The first of three furnaces is currently operational, at an annualised rate of approximately 24,000 tonnes of blister copper. Work has commenced on expanding the capacity of the facility to 50,000 tonnes of blister copper with the re-commissioning of the second furnace.
